Doomed Definitions
1 of 3) Doomed, Ill-Fated, Ill-Omened, Ill-Starred, Unlucky : بدبخت, بدقسمت : (satellite adjective) marked by or promising bad fortune.
Their business venture was doomed from the start.
2 of 3) Doomed, Lost : قریب المرگ, جو مرنے والا ہو : (noun) people who are destined to die soon.
The agony of the doomed was in his voice.
3 of 3) Doomed, Cursed, Damned, Unredeemed, Unsaved : سزا یافتہ, غیر محفوظ : (satellite adjective) in danger of the eternal punishment of Hell.
